Description
Loaded Baked Potato Salad is a delightful twist on the classic baked potato, combining comforting flavors with a creamy salad texture. This crowd-pleaser features tender russet potatoes mixed with crispy bacon, sharp cheddar cheese, and fresh green onions, all enveloped in a rich sour cream and mayo dressing. Perfect for potlucks, barbecues, or family gatherings, this versatile side dish can be made ahead of time and served chilled to allow the flavors to meld beautifully. Ingredients
- 4 pounds russet potatoes
- 12 ounces bacon
- 1 ½ cups medium cheddar cheese (shredded)
- 6 green onions (chopped)
- 1 cup mayonnaise
- ¾ cup sour cream
- 3 tablespoons apple cider vinegar
- Olive oil, salt, and pepper
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 400°F.
- Pierce cleaned potatoes several times with a fork, coat lightly with olive oil and kosher salt, and bake for 50-60 minutes until tender.
- Let cool for 5 minutes; peel and cut into chunks while still warm. Drizzle with apple cider vinegar.
- Cook bacon until crispy; crumble once cooled.
- Mix mayonnaise and sour cream with seasoning; combine with potatoes, bacon, green onions, and cheese in a large bowl.
- Chill in the refrigerator for at least three hours before serving.
